CEO’s statement
Andy Leaver, Chief Executive Officer, noted, “Broad recognition for the need to address the cryptographic cybersecurity risk posed by quantum computers now exists. While the U.S. National Security Memorandum 10 has been mandating government migration to a post-quantum security posture since 2022, other countries including the U.K. and Canada have more recently been mandating post-quantum migration as well. The commercial market is now on board with leading players like Google, IBM and Cloudflare recently accelerating timetables for post-quantum migration to 2029. Even that time horizon may be too distant as IonQ recently announced it has accelerated its roadmap for a quantum computer with a logical qubit count sufficient to challenge RSA 2048 to the 2028 to 2029 window. The threat to cybersecurity is real and the time to begin addressing it is now.
With the commercial launch in the period of Arqit’s Encryption Intelligence cryptographic risk-analysis tools and advisory service, Arqit is well positioned to help governments and enterprises take the initial steps in migrating to a post-quantum cryptographic security posture. Organizations need to understand their current architectures and embedded risks before they can implement post-quantum solutions. Arqit this week signed its first Encryption Intelligence related contract and, also, executed an Encryption Intelligence partnership agreement with a European specialist cybersecurity provider focused on PQC migration for financial services organizations. We see multiple near-term opportunities for Encryption Intelligence either directly with customers or through channel partners. We believe Encryption Intelligence is an important addition to Arqit’s ability to provide an end-to-end PQC migration offering.
Our post-quantum cryptographic solutions, led by our NetworkSecure™ product, offer clients software based cryptographically agile post-quantum solutions. Current applications include securing data in transit (e.g. secure VPNs) and data in process (e.g. quantum secure data computation on Intel Netsec accelerator cards). The applicability of Arqit’s post-quantum cryptographic solutions is broad. Current implementations include an international bank securing its data traffic via a Tier 1 telecom partner, a defence contractor securing communications of a major government’s research network and a defence contractor securing tactical control of unmanned platforms for a major European Ministry of Defence. We see increasing engagement and demand for our quantum secure cryptographic solutions in our key target markets of telecommunications, government and defence as evidenced by our increased contract activity during the period in these markets.
With heightened urgency in the marketplace and a complete end-to-end PQC migration product offering, we believe Arqit is well positioned for success. The sell-through of our solutions by current partners, the renewal and upsizing of certain existing contracts and our increasing contract base give us confidence in the direction of the business.”

About Arqit
Arqit Quantum Inc. (Nasdaq: ARQQ, ARQQW) secures the world’s most critical data with quantum-safe encryption software. Simple, scalable, and compliant, its products integrate with existing infrastructure, requiring no hardware changes. Arqit provides a complete “Detect, Protect, Comply” solution for governments and enterprises that protects data, ensures compliance, and safeguards their transition to the post-quantum era.
Arqit’s primary product offerings are Encryption Intelligence and NetworkSecure™. Encryption Intelligence detects cryptographic exposure, identifies vulnerabilities, and maps dependencies. NetworkSecure™ protects data in transit with provably secure post-quantum cryptography and contributes to establishment of confidential compute environments for complete data sovereignty.
